Modified: trunk/dports/math/octave-devel/Portfile (149049 => 149050)
--- trunk/dports/math/octave-devel/Portfile 2016-05-26 14:06:04 UTC (rev 149049)
+++ trunk/dports/math/octave-devel/Portfile 2016-05-26 17:23:57 UTC (rev 149050)
@@ -111,14 +111,24 @@
select.group octave
select.file ${filespath}/${subport}
-# check http://hg.savannah.gnu.org/hgweb/octave/gnulib-hg/rev for latest version
-set hg_gnu_tag 4a3a7c6111c8
+# see ${worksrcpath}/.hgsubstate to find revision of gnulib-hg subrepository that should be used
+if { ${subport} eq "octave-devel-rc" || ${subport} eq "octave-devel-release" } {
+ set hg_gnu_tag 7f19e7f2afa2
-checksums-append \
- ${hg_gnu_tag}${extract.suffix} \
- rmd160 367b2811b5d4e3bab5ed22382c4ecfed808335e7 \
- sha256 39f09d2000654d0d75a95b756fdd0724f869dfe65ef08f47814fbad230e8b25c
+ checksums-append \
+ ${hg_gnu_tag}${extract.suffix} \
+ rmd160 9d906212fdb4201f8592da10524606dadb3f50e3 \
+ sha256 85add8ce0c53e8868d903c28c407d864ca54bd42e8d472e09b1a1bb4b105b741
+} else {
+ # check http://hg.savannah.gnu.org/hgweb/octave/gnulib-hg/rev for latest version
+ set hg_gnu_tag 4a3a7c6111c8
+ checksums-append \
+ ${hg_gnu_tag}${extract.suffix} \
+ rmd160 367b2811b5d4e3bab5ed22382c4ecfed808335e7 \
+ sha256 39f09d2000654d0d75a95b756fdd0724f869dfe65ef08f47814fbad230e8b25c
+}
+
master_sites http://hg.savannah.gnu.org/hgweb/octave/archive:octave \
http://hg.savannah.gnu.org/hgweb/octave/gnulib-hg/archive:gnulib